Dr. Babasaheb AmbedkarWaiting for a Visa by Dr. B. R. Ambedkar is a brief autobiographical account written in 193536. It illuminates the pervasive castebased discrimination faced by the Dalit community. The title metaphorically suggests the Dalits ongoing struggle for acceptance and dignity in Indian society.Key ChaptersChildhood Experiences : Ambedkar recalls being denied help during his childhood travels due to his untouchable status, leaving lasting trauma.Academic Discrimination : Despite his advanced degrees, Ambedkar was refused accommodation and faced profound disrespect upon returning to India.Transport Refusal : Hindu tongawallas refused to transport Ambedkar, highlighting dangerous, deep rooted intolerance.Superstition of Impurity : Casteism perpetuates beliefs in impurity and contamination, contrary to religious teachings on compassion.Medical Negligence : A Dalit woman died in childbirth as a doctor refused care, showcasing deadly castebased discrimination in healthcare.Professional Disrespect : A Bhangi boy, despite his post as a scribe, faced disrespect due to his caste, forcing him to leave his job.Historical Context : Discrimination against Shudras and untouchables has deep historical roots, with Ambedkars activism aiming to combat these injustices.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"Saket Prakashan Pvt.
